Job Description
- Oversee daily onsite operations for retail and restaurant interior construction projects.
- Manage subcontractors, coordinate tight schedules, and drive projects toward on‑time openings.
- Maintain safety, quality, cleanliness, and efficient site logistics.
- Track progress through daily reports, inspections, and punchlists.
- Collaborate closely with Project Managers, designers, and ownership teams to resolve issues quickly and keep projects moving.
